I have the park PCS-1 which lists for 150 but I got for $125 from performance a month or so ago. I think that I saw it in some other catalogs (nashbar, performance, ??) for $125 recently. It is a nice stand with adjustable height and good support.

I bought the Minoura RS 4000 from Bike Nashbar. It’s much sturdier than I expected it to be. So far I am happy with it and getting a stand was a great investment. If I never use it for anything else than making it easier to wash my bike it will have been worth it.
